		<description><![CDATA[Lark chats with George Thorogood about his incredible career making high energy boogie blues rock and roll.  George Thorogood & The Destroyers are coming to the Pearl Concert Theater on Friday, July 25th at 8pm. Get tickets here: https://www.palms.com/entertainment/pearl-theater/george-thorogood-the-destroyers On the evening of December 1st, 1973, at The University of Delaware’s Lane Hall, a guitarist, a drummer, and their rhythm guitarist set up their gear – including a borrowed PA – on the small bandstand. Though the three-piece band had only rehearsed once or twice, guitarist George Thorogood and drummer Jeff Simon had been bashing out covers of songs they loved – including ‘No Particular Place To Go’, ‘Madison Blues’ and ‘One Bourbon, One Scotch, One Beer’ – in suburban Wilmington basements since they were teens. Then there’s an ongoing legacy unlike any in Rock history: By reverently reinventing obscure blues, country and R&B tracks by icons that include Bo Diddley, John Lee Hooker and Hank Williams – via now-classic hits like ‘Who Do You Love?’, ‘Boogie Chillun’ and ‘Move It On Over’ – George Thorogood and The Destroyers have kept the music of these American Masters alive for the MTV Generation and beyond. And with his own smash originals such as ‘I Drink Alone,’ ‘Gear Jammer,’ and the ultimate badass anthem ‘Bad To The Bone,’ Thorogood and band have forged a one-of-a-kind career built on humor, fervor and six-string swagger delivered with equal parts fire and fun. “The dreams we had as teenagers all came true,” Jeff Simon says. “We’ve shared stages with our music heroes. We perform for audiences all over the world. We’ve always stayed true to who we are. And most of all, we still love what we do.”]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[Lark interviews the legendary drummer, Steve Smith.  Steve is the well-known drummer of Journey across three stints: 1978 to 1985, 1995 to 1998 and 2015 to 2020. Modern Drummer magazine readers have voted him the No. 1 All-Around Drummer five years in a row. Steve Smith is in Las Vegas on April 12th @ Myrons at the Smith Center with his Jazz group Vital Information doing covers of famous Journey songs he played on (all re-arranged and interpreted in the Jazz style) as well as songs from their new album “New Perspective” and more. 		<description><![CDATA[Lark interviews Zakk Wylde.  This in-depth interview goes deep into Zakk's history; plus they talk about Zakk Sabbath Greatest Riffs and the upcoming "King Of The Monstours" show coming to Brooklyn Bowl on Wednesday, December 4th. Zakk Sabbath is proud to announce the release of “Greatest Riffs,” a digital collection celebrating the iconic music of Black Sabbath and their legendary guitarist, Tony Iommi. Featuring a handpicked selection of tracks, this release pays tribute to the band that defined heavy metal for generations.  Formed by Zakk Wylde in 2014, Zakk Sabbath has brought the music of Black Sabbath to life through explosive live performances and recordings. For the first time, fans can enjoy “Greatest Riffs” on all major streaming platforms. This digital release brings together some of the most powerful and enduring songs from the Zakk Sabbath albums ‘Vertigo' and 'Doomed Forever Forever Doomed', previously only available in physical formats. (Live In Detroit (2017), Vertigo (2020), and Doomed Forever Forever Doomed (2024). To celebrate this release, Zakk Sabbath will embark on the "King of the Monstours" US tour, a 30-city trek across the country. Zakk Sabbath will be headlining with support from ZOSO (Led Zeppelin tribute) and The Iron Maidens (all-female Iron Maiden tribute), offering a unique experience that honors the foundational spirit of all that is Heavy Metal. “I was asked to name five essential things that make life great, 1. Great Friend, 2. Great Pizza, 3. Black Sabbath, 4. Zed Zeppelin, 5. Iron Maiden.” -Zakk Wylde]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[Bert Kreischer chatted with Foxx and Mackenzie on Thursday morning to talk about his new show: Bert Kreischer: Double Down featuring Bobby Lee with back-to-back performances at Resorts World this weekend.... Friday, September 27 and 28. “I love Vegas, so it was a no-brainer when this opportunity came up,” says Kreischer. “The parties, the lights, it’s the perfect energy for a show like this. Book the flight or plan a road trip and bring out the boys for a wild weekend!!” Celebrated as Rolling Stone Magazine’s “Number One Partier in the Nation,” Kreischer has become one of the top-grossing stand-up comics in the industry. Kreischer’s talents have also taken over the silver screen, starring in the major motion picture The Machine from Sony Pictures. In March of 2023, Kreischer released his fifth stand-up special, Razzle Dazzle, the follow-up to his previous stand-up specials, Secret Time, The Machine, and Hey Big Boy – all available for streaming on Netflix – and shows no signs of slowing down. Next week, Kreischer will shoot his sixth Netflix special in his hometown of Tampa, FL., selling out all six shows in one day following their announcement. In addition to being named “one of the US’s top stand-ups over the past decade” by The Guardian, Kreischer has been celebrated for his popular podcast, Bertcast, with over 600 episodes, and 2 Bears 1 Cave with Tom Segura, which consistently charts in the top 10 comedy podcasts worldwide. Kreischer also created, hosts, and produces the YouTube cooking show Something’s Burning, which has earned over 33.2M views. No stranger to Las Vegas, Kreischer’s all-new show Bert Kreischer: Double Down promises fans two nights of must-see, laugh-out-loud comedy that has never been seen before and is not to be missed.
